KLAS research highlights Commure’s differentiated true ambient scribe technology, seamless integrations, and white-glove support model with forward-deployed engineers
MOUNTAIN VIEW, Calif., Aug. 27,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Commure, a leading healthcare technology company, today announced that its Commure Ambient AI solution has been spotlighted in a 2025 KLAS First Look Report for its ability to dramatically reduce provider documentation burden, improve accuracy, and enhance patient-provider interactions.
The report, based on interviews with a select sample of customers across health systems and clinics, scored Commure Ambient AI a strong 93.3 with 100% of respondents saying they would buy Commure Ambient AI again. Commure Ambient AI earned high marks for its demonstrated ability to reduce documentation time, improve collection rates and decrease denial rates, and positively impact burnout for providers.

Commure Ambient AI is part of Commure’s next-generation infrastructure that draws on the company’s roots in RCM and applies a revenue-focused approach with AI solutions spanning patient intake and provider care delivery through to back-office claim and payment.
“Beyond reducing provider burnout, Commure Ambient AI connects clinical work to financial outcomes of the organization,” said Tanay Tandon, CEO of Commure. “Healthcare is buried under a massive work tax, and Ambient AI is one of the critical tools to solve it. Its true power comes from being part of an end-to-end AI solution with revenue cycle as the backbone.”
The recognition from KLAS adds to Commure’s momentum as the company continues to partner with more than 100 enterprise customers and thousands of small-to-medium-sized healthcare organizations nationwide.
